Oblique versus level windlasses
Both raise a weight equally per turn, but the oblique drum gathers twice the cord and ends lower
Folio 168v turns to the argano (windlass or winch), comparing an oblique drum c d with a level one a b. Leonardo argues that, with cords and drums of equal thickness, both raise their weight equally high per turn, though the oblique drum can gather twice as much cord while its last coil ends lower. He adds that a longer cord and a more acute angle make the lift slower, that the windlass pulling between more unequal angles gathers the most cord, and that gathering more cord means raising the weight less high. The right-hand sketches show cranked winches with cords and hanging weights, numbered 39 to 41.

Oblique versus level windlass
The oblique windlass c d raises its weight, turn for turn, as high as the level windlass a b when the cords and drums are of equal thickness. The oblique one can gather twice as much cord, but its last part remains so much the lower.
Cord length and angle govern speed of lift
The longer the cord m o is than the cord a n, the more slowly it raises its weight; likewise the more acute the angle b compared with the angle r, the slower the motion of b than of r.
More cord gathered means less height gained
Among windlasses of equal thickness, the one that pulls between more unequal angles gathers more cord; and the windlass that gathers more cord raises the weight less high.
